Booking Your First Appointment

When you book your first dental visit in Orangeville, you’ll likely be asked a few questions to get started. Clinics need basic health history, current concerns, and insurance information. Many Orangeville dentists accepting new patients offer online forms or in-person paperwork for this step.

Arriving at the Clinic

Once you arrive for your first dental exam in Orangeville, the team will greet you and review your patient forms. Staff are trained to work with first-time patients and are happy to answer questions. It’s okay to feel a little nervous—your comfort matters.

Initial Dental Consultation

The initial dental consultation in Orangeville usually begins with a friendly conversation. Your dentist or dental hygienist will ask about your oral health habits, medical background, and any issues you may be experiencing like tooth pain or gum sensitivity.

New Patient Dental Exam

Your new patient dental exam is a thorough check of your mouth, teeth, gums, and jaw. The dentist may take digital X-rays to see what’s happening below the surface. This helps spot problems early and creates a clear picture of your dental health.

First Time Dental Cleaning in Orangeville

Many patients also receive a first-time dental cleaning in Orangeville during their visit. The hygienist will remove plaque and tartar from your teeth and polish them. This leaves your smile feeling fresh and clean.

Next Steps After Your Visit

At the end of your Orangeville dental clinic appointment, the dentist will go over any findings and recommend next steps. This could include treatment for cavities, a follow-up cleaning, or simply scheduling your next checkup.
